Показать сообщение отдельно
  #1 (permalink)  
Старый 02.12.2020, 02:24
Интересующийся
Отправить личное сообщение для ColT Посмотреть профиль Найти все сообщения от ColT
 
Регистрация: 14.02.2020
Сообщений: 16

Закрытие и открытие блока
Всем привет, помогите переписать немного скрипт

function initMenu() {
  $('#menu ul').hide();
  $('#menu ul').children('.current').parent().show();
  //$('#menu ul:first').show();
  $('#menu li a').click(
    function() {
      var checkElement = $(this).next();
      if((checkElement.is('ul')) && (checkElement.is(':visible'))) {
        return false;
        }
      if((checkElement.is('ul')) && (!checkElement.is(':visible'))) {
        $('#menu ul:visible').slideUp('normal');
        checkElement.slideDown('normal');
        return false;
        }
      }
    );
  }
$(document).ready(function() {initMenu();});


скрипт аккордеон. Он открывает блок, но при повторном нажатии его не закрывает.
Помогите пожалуйста сделать что бы и закрывалось при повторном клике на ту же кнопку.
Ответить с цитированием